Screw Length For Two 2X4 . Generally, the ideal screw length for a 2×4 is around 2 1/2 inches to 3 inches long. The most common screw size for framing with 2x4s is 3 inches long, which provides plenty of depth to screw into the wood without the risk of splitting or weakening the boards. If you're joining them face to face, that's 3 inches thick. It ensures firm joinery with deep enough penetration without going through the opposite side.
